Uncle was wondering when 'Two dads' would return - he'd gone up in a tripehound for a change to get the feel of it along with young Will Power but Power had returned to base a short time later with magneto trouble.
Strictly speaking Baz should have still been on the sick list but Uncle had allowed it as it was quiet over the front since the Battle of the Somme had come to a close shortly before Christmas and Baz was an experienced pilot, even if he had yet to make his mark on the scoreboard.
Uncle heard the unmistakable sound of a blipping rotary engine approaching the field and got up from his desk to see if he could make out who it was as it felt still a bit early to be Baz.
As he got to the window he saw the Tripehound stagger over the perimeter hedge, trailing strips of fabric and loose wires in it's wake; as it's wheels made contact with terra firma the undercarriage shed one of it's wheels, dug into the sod and buckling with a crack like a pistol shot slewed the whole machine violently to it's left whereupon it folded into itself becoming an ungainly pile of splintered wood and torn fabric.
Uncle was already out the door as the M.O appeared from his office, bag in hand and running toward the scene along with many other squadron members when Baz stood upright and stepped out of the remains of his cockpit and tottered away from the wreckage, blood streaming from his nose.
Cleaned and bandaged up a pale faced Baz sat before Uncle and recounted what had happened that morning.
"Well sir, it's like this, once Power signalled me he was having engine troubles and turned back I thought I would carry on over the lines and have a peek on the other side to see what was stooging about. I'd flown under some clouds as I crossed no mans land and something made me look over my shoulder and I'm flaming glad I did as sat almost right above me like a hungry Wedge Tail was a flippin' Hun".
"Before I could do anything he was diving on me with his gun blazing and rounds were crashing through the frame damaging my controls"
"I pulled round and up to the left as quick as I could hoping to throw him off but he somehow managed to keep his gun on me as he slid about my tail"
"I kept the climbing turn on and managed to shake off his aim"
"Not being able to carry on to my left I reversed the turn sharply to the right hoping that I might catch him turning after me but the beggar simply reversed direction out of my reach"
"He was clearly a good pilot as he immediately turned after me"
"I turned sharply after him again and managed to catch him with a long range burst as he continued his turn, managing to keep out of his reach"
"I couldn't keep a bead on him but slipped behind his tail"
"I turned in sharply again, catching him a fourpenny one as he reversed -I thought I might have hit him but maybe not - He gave as good as he got though, damaging my engine but I reckon I was still as fast as him so tried to draw him back over the lines "
""Keeping my sharp turn on I whipped behind his tail and I caught him out again moments later"
"As I headed back over the lines he reversed again and chased after me"
"My hope was to draw him in, which I managed to do, but I only managed a glancing blow and my gun jammed for a moment"
(Perfect Aim)
"I gave it one more go but the beggar reversed once more and shot me up good and proper"
(Perfect Aim)
"It was time to take my leave and I dived away, heading for our side of the lines 'toot sweet' "
"I thought I might be away free and clear but I saw he was coming back to finish me off "
"He was closing in fast, then I could hear the gun chattering and I thought I was a goner but luck must have been riding with me and he somehow missed the bit of sky with your truly in it."
